INDIANAPOLIS — The “biggest” season in Big Ten history got its start this week as all 18 members of the conference descended on the Circle City for the annual Big Ten Football Media Days.

For decades this event was held in hotels or convention centers in downtown Chicago, but it moved to Indianapolis in 2021 to utilize more room at Lucas Oil Stadium while social distancing was still being practiced because of COVID-19.

Though everyone is allowed to stand close together again, extra space was certainly necessary with the league expanding this year.
